The glycemic index (GI) of foods, or the extent to which a food increases serum glucose concentrations, may also affect weight change or body composition. Foods with a high GI may affect specific metabolic processes, such as lipolysis, lipogenesis, or substrate oxidation. These processes, in turn, may impact hunger, satiety, food intake, or energy expenditure, all of which could influence energy balance and body composition.

Food sensitivity and inflammation

Food is central to our health. The food we eat gives our bodies the information and materials they need to function properly. If we eat too much food, or food that gives our bodies the wrong instructions, our metabolic processes suffer and our health declines. For example, a diet with too much fat can be harmful, but some fat is necessary for the body to make energy, build certain cell structures, absorb certain vitamins, and protect our organs. A balanced diet helps ensure we get all the nutrients our bodies need.

However, the relationship between diet and inflammation is still under investigation, as is the role that food sensitivities play in overall inflammation. Food sensitivity occurs when a certain food prompts the immune system to create internal inflammation. This can cause joint aches, chronic allergies and congestion, chronic skin rashes, bloating, constipation, diarrhea, and migraine headaches. Food sensitivity is usually the result of an underlying digestive condition like increased intestinal permeability, or as it’s colloquially called, ‘leaky gut.’ Leaky gut could be caused by bacterial gut imbalances, gastrointestinal diseases, stress, inflammation, poor digestion, certain medications, toxins, or infections.

Food sensitivities are different from food allergies, but both involve inflammation. Food allergies occur when the immune system elicits a response to certain foods (like nuts or shellfish) and causes rashes, nasal congestion, nausea, swelling of the lips or tongue, and the most serious reaction, anaphylaxis, where the airways narrow and inhibit breathing. Unlike some food allergies, food sensitivities are not life-threatening and do not directly involve the immune system. People with food sensitivities may experience bloating, fullness, belly pain, gas, or diarrhea when they eat too much of the food they are intolerant of. Their body cannot properly digest the food, leading to a buildup of air and gas in the stomach and intestines.

Some of the same foods related to inflammation can also cause food sensitivity symptoms, such as lactose and gluten. Cardiometabolic diseases and dietary factors

Diet has a significant impact on health and body composition. While genes define characteristics like the likelihood of getting certain diseases, they also interact with our diet, which may affect how our bodies break down food. For instance, the Standard American Diet (SAD) is known to compromise nutrition, as most packaged foods have their natural nutrients removed during the refining process.

Cardiometabolic diseases, including cardiovascular diseases, type 2 diabetes mellitus, and Metabolic Syndrome (MetS), are the leading causes of morbidity and mortality in the United States and globally. These diseases are influenced by a range of biological, demographic, dietary, behavioral, and environmental factors. Dietary risk is a critical and highly modifiable factor in the development of cardiometabolic diseases.

Dietary fats, in particular, have been the subject of extensive research due to their complex health effects on cardiometabolic diseases. Dietary fats are composed of diverse molecules with varying structures, and emerging studies support the notion that individual dietary fats have distinct health effects. For example, saturated fatty acids are associated with an increased risk of coronary heart disease and other cardiometabolic lipid risk factors. However, it's important to note that the health effects of dietary fats can be influenced by other factors, such as accompanying nutrients and food-processing methods.

Packaged foods, which are often processed, can compromise nutrition. Processing can remove natural nutrients, and additional chemicals are often used to enhance taste, preserve the food, or change its colour. These chemicals may include preservatives, artificial flavourings, colours, and sweeteners. While most food additives have been tested for safety, their use remains controversial. Chemically processed foods, or ultra-processed foods, tend to be high in sugar, artificial ingredients, refined carbohydrates, and trans fats. These foods are major contributors to obesity and illness worldwide.

Ultra-processed foods have been linked to an increased risk of cardiovascular disease, coronary heart disease, and cerebrovascular disorders. They also tend to be high in saturated fats and salt, which can be harmful if consumed in excess. Whole foods, in contrast, provide more dietary fibre and vitamins. For example, meal kits may list the nutritional content of the raw ingredients, but the cooked meal may have different nutritional values due to the addition of oil, salt, and other ingredients during cooking, as well as the loss of some nutrients during the cooking process.

Frequently asked questions

Body weight is the component that is most affected by diet. A healthy body weight is the first step in reducing cardiovascular risk.

The average person needs about 2,000 calories every day to maintain their weight, but this depends on their age, sex, and physical activity level.

A balanced diet is an important part of maintaining good health and can help you feel your best. It includes eating a wide variety of foods in the right proportions and consuming the right amount of food and drink to achieve and maintain a healthy body weight.

The Eatwell Guide suggests eating at least 5 portions of a variety of fruit and vegetables every day, basing meals on higher-fibre starchy foods, and consuming some dairy or dairy alternatives. It's also important to get enough protein and choose unsaturated oils and spreads.

Diet can affect health in many ways. For example, a diet high in saturated fat can increase cholesterol levels and the risk of heart disease. Regularly consuming foods and drinks high in sugar increases the risk of obesity and tooth decay. Eating a healthy, balanced diet that includes a variety of nutrients can help reduce these risks and improve overall health.
